Just wanted to share maybe it’ll be helpful for some people that shoot dots.  I figured this out a few years ago when my RMR screws on my Glock got stripped. 
(Note: I bought this as is)
1. Pretty much carefully drill it slightly.
2. Find a torx bit that is a bit oversize from the hole you drilled.
3. Slightly hammer the bit into it.
4. Remove with 1/4” ratchet for best leverage.

Same thing happened to one of my red dots. Ended up just drilling the screw head out til it snapped. And then used pliers to remove the rest of the screw from mount. I’ve tried using those screw extractor bits. I’ve followed all video instructions but they seem to not work for me
